I love this item!: In-Ear Headphones

Love it! I just ordered another one! I'm an (amateur) gravel cyclist and don't want to use wireless headphones as I fall often. So I needed something to keep my headphones from getting tangled up with my backpack/water carrier when I'm not riding. He does exactly what he says. I think it's easy to use. Great idea but not practical

I was really hoping it would be great. I mean, it's solidly made and looks like a great design that solves the age-old problem of headphone confusion. Spring. It works out. Like, like, something like. Inserting the end of the fork is fairly easy. Then wrap the cable around the C end. Finally, the headphones are plugged in at the side. Easy right?
